MySQL是關系型數據庫管理系統的一種,它廣泛應用于各種Web應用程序開發。作為一名開發人員,深入學習MySQL數據庫可以幫助我們更好地實現數據的存儲和管理。下面將介紹一些關于MySQL數據庫深入學習的方面。
一、MySQL的基本特點
MySQL是一個開源的、快速的、可靠的、易于使用的關系型數據庫管理系統。它支持標準SQL語言,具有多線程處理能力,同時還支持多用戶訪問,并且提供了一個完整的管理系統。
二、MySQL數據庫的安裝
在Linux操作系統下,MySQL的安裝需要通過命令行進行。具體步驟如下: 1. 下載MySQL安裝包(通常為.tar.gz格式) 2. 解壓安裝包 3. 安裝依賴庫 4. 運行./configure命令進行編譯 5. 運行make命令進行安裝 6. 運行make install命令進行安裝 安裝完成后,我們可以啟動MySQL服務,并通過命令行登錄到MySQL數據庫中進行操作。
三、MySQL數據庫的建立
MySQL數據庫的建立需要先創建數據庫,然后在數據庫中創建表。具體步驟如下: 1. 登錄到MySQL數據庫中 2. 創建數據庫(CREATE DATABASE db_name;) 3. 選擇數據庫(USE db_name;) 4. 創建數據表(CREATE TABLE table_name( id INT(11) NOT NULL, name VARCHAR(20) NOT NULL, age INT(11) NOT NULL, PRIMARY KEY(id) );) 通過以上步驟,我們成功建立了一個簡單的MySQL數據庫。
四、MySQL的常用命令
在MySQL數據庫中,常用的命令如下: 1. SELECT: 查找數據 2. INSERT: 添加數據 3. UPDATE: 更新數據 4. DELETE: 刪除數據 5. SHOW: 顯示數據庫信息 6. USE: 選擇數據庫 7. CREATE: 創建數據庫或數據表 8. ALTER: 修改數據表結構 9. DROP: 刪除數據庫或數據表 10. COMMIT: 數據庫事務提交 11. ROLLBACK: 數據庫事務回滾 熟練掌握這些命令可以更高效地進行MySQL數據庫的操作。
總之,MySQL數據庫是Web應用程序開發人員必須學習的技術之一。通過深入學習,我們可以更好地應用MySQL,實現數據的存儲和管理,在Web應用程序開發中提高我們的效率和質量。
上一篇css圖片移動遮罩
下一篇mysql數據庫測評整改